What you will be doing

Ricoh are currently recruiting for a Project Manager on a FTC, based in our London offices who will own and manage the delivery of assigned projects within schedule and quality constraints. As part of the role you will also be responsible for managing all communications across the delivery team of the project and reporting delivery status, risks and issues arising through the engagement.

Additionally you will be required to support global projects by working under the supervision of a Global Project Manager as part of a broader Project Team, by managing the delivery of assigned work packages within the overall engagement and collaborating with the owning Global Project Manager to minimise rework and maximise customer satisfaction.

  • Promoting the wider public good in all actions, acting in a morally, legally and socially appropriate manner in dealings with stakeholders and members of project teams and the organisation
  • Adopting the 7 Ricoh Way Values
  • Be a strong team player with a particular focus on enabling the objectives of the project and applying project management practices.
  • Develop / maintain implementation schedules for all assigned project / work package activities and events, taking account of dependencies and resource requirements. Contribute as instructed to the development and timely update of project initiation and control documentation.
  • Properly brief the delivery team members to ensure that the requirements of the implementation schedule are understood, track / report status and support the proactive escalation of requests for help from the work teams.
  • Coordinate assignment of necessary resources to perform project activities.
  • Responsible for identification and proactive management of project / work package risks, escalating issues where necessary to ensure timely resolution.
  • Support and implement project change control.

You will ideally have

Ideal candidates will have previous experience of working in a similar Project Management focused role, and ideally will be working towards, or be in possession of, a minimum project management certification in one of the following recognised project management standards: Certified Associate in Project Management (CAPM) or PRINCE2 Foundation or APM Project Fundamentals Qualification (PFQ), and demonstrable progress towards attaining the more advanced PMI PMP or PRINCE2 Practitioner or APM Project Management Qualification (PMQ).

Successful candidates will have proficiency in MS Office, incl. MS Project and MS Visio and be accustomed to working with project planning tools and techniques, project management principles, governance and compliance.

Candidates who are degree educated or hold similar professional qualification and the ITIL v3 Foundation or ITIL 4 Foundation would be highly desirable.

Preferably candidates will have a proven ability to lead and own projects (or other equivalent work) and to develop relationships with key customer contacts and stakeholders.
